Lawar Palla is a Rural village located in Satpuli, Pauri-garhwal, Uttarakhand.

The total population of Lawar Palla is 140.

Lawar Palla village comprises 31 households.

The literacy rate in Lawar Palla is 76%. Among the literate population of 92, there are 55 literate males and 37 literate females.

In Lawar Palla, there are 76 males and 64 females, with a sex ratio of 842 females per 1000 males.

There are 19 children (13.6% of population), comprising 10 boys and 9 girls.

The total number of workers in Lawar Palla is 47, with 2 main workers and 45 marginal workers.

In Lawar Palla, there are 115 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(57 males, 58 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Lawar Palla is located in Uttarakhand state, Pauri-garhwal district, and falls under Satpuli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 47796 and LGD code is 47796.
